The 220V 30A relay is designed to handle high voltage and current levels, making it suitable for a wide range of industrial and commercial applications. It is a type of electromechanical relay that uses an electromagnet to control the switching of electrical circuits. The relay operates on a 220V AC supply and can handle a maximum current of 30A.
**Applications of 220V 30A Relay**
The 220V 30A relay finds its application in various industries, including:
1. **Industrial Automation**: These relays are widely used in industrial automation systems for controlling high-power circuits. They are ideal for applications such as motor control, lighting control, and machine control.
2. **Home Appliances**: The relay’s ability to handle high current makes it suitable for home appliances such as air conditioners, refrigerators, and washing machines.
3. **Electric Vehicles**: In the rapidly growing electric vehicle industry, 220V 30A relays are used for battery management and motor control systems.
4. **Solar Power Systems**: These relays are used in solar power systems for controlling the flow of electricity from solar panels to the grid.
**Specifications of 220V 30A Relay**
The key specifications of a 220V 30A relay include:
1. **Voltage Rating**: The relay operates on a 220V AC supply, making it suitable for applications requiring high voltage.
2. **Current Rating**: The relay can handle a maximum current of 30A, which is suitable for high-power applications.
3. **Contact Rating**: The relay has a contact rating of 30A at 220V AC, ensuring reliable switching of electrical circuits.
4. **Operating Temperature**: The relay is designed to operate within a temperature range of -40°C to +85°C, making it suitable for various environmental conditions.
5. **Life Cycle**: The relay has a minimum of 100,000 operations, ensuring long-term reliability in critical applications.
